BEFORE
STARTING
ENGgNE
OIL (See Fig. 9)
Your lawn mower is shipped without oil in the engine_
o
Be sure mower is level and area around oil fill is clean.
o
Remove engine oil cap w/dipstick and fill to the full line
on the dipstick.
,
Use 20 ozs. of oil. For type and grade of oil to use, see
"ENGINE" in Customer Responsibilities
section of this
manual.
o
Pour oil slowly. Do not over fill.
=
Check oil level before each use. Add oil if needed. Fill
to full line on dipstick.
o
To read proper level, tighten engine oil cap each time.
o
Reinstall engine oil cap and tighten.
o
After the first two (2) hours of mowing, change the oil,
and every 25 hours thereafter.
You may need to
change the oil more often under dusty, dirty conditions.
ADD GASOLINE
(See Fig. 9)
Fill fuel tank=
Use fresh, clean, regular unleaded
gasoline with a minimum of 87 octane_ (Use of leaded
gasoline will increase carbon and lead oxide deposits
and reduce valve life).
Do not mix oil with gasoline,
Purchase fuel in quantities that can be used within 30
days to assure fuel freshness.
IMPORTANT:
WHEN OPERATING IN TEMPERATURES
BELOW 32°F(0°C), USE FRESH, CLEAN WINTER GRADE
GASOLINE TO HELP INSURE GOOD COLD WEATHER
STARTING
WARNING:
Experience
indicates that alcohol blended
fuels (called gasohol or using ethanol or methanol) can
attract moisture which leads to separation and formation of
acids during storage
Acidic gas can damage the fuel
system of an engine while in storage.
To avoid engine
problems, the fuel system should be emptied before stor-
age of 30 days or longer
Drain the gas tank, start the
engine and let it run until the fuel lines and carburetor are
empty, Use fresh fuet next season.
See Storage Instruc-
tions for additional
information.
Never use engine or
carburetor cleaner products in the fuel tank or permanent
damage may occur
CAUTION:
Fill to bottom of gas tank
filler neck. Do not overfill. Wipe offany
spilled oil or fuel, Do not store, spill or
use gasoline near an open flame.
TO START
ENGINE
=
To start a cold engine, push primer three (3) times
before trying to start, Use a firm push. This step is not
usually necessary when starting an engine which has
already run for a few minutes,
o
Move engine speed controI lever to fast (,_) position,
o
Hold operator presence control bar down to the handle
and pull starter handle quickly. Do not allow starter
rope to snap back,
To stop, engine, release operator presence control bar.
NOTE:
In cooler weather it may be necessary to repeat
priming steps. In warmer weather over priming may cause
flooding and engine will not start
If you do flood engine,
wait a few minutes before attempting to start and do not
repeat priming steps.

MOWINGTIPS
Under certain conditions, such as very tall grass, itmay
be necessary to raise the height of cut to reduce
pushing effort and to keep from overloading the engine
and leaving clumps of grass clippings.
o
For extremely heavy cutting, reduce the width of cut
and raise the rear of the lawn mower housing one (1)
wheel adjuster setting higher than the front for better
discharge of grass.
°
For better grass bagging and most cutting conditions,
the engine speed should be set in the fast (,_) position.
When using a rear discharge lawn mower in moist,
heavy grass, clumps of cut grass may not enter the
grass catcher, Reduce ground speed (pushing speed)
and/or runthe lawn mower over the area a second time.
o
If a trail of grass clippings is left on the right side of a rear
discharge lawn mower, mow in a clockwise direction
with a small overlap to collect the clippings on the next
pass.
.
Keep top of engine around starter clear and clean of
grass clippings and chaff_ This wil! help engine airflow
and extend engine life.
.
Pores in cloth grass catchers can become fiiled with dirt
and dust with use and catchers will collect less grass
To prevent this, regularly hose catchers off with water
and let dry before using°
